How much do assistant stadium usher j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 15, 2026, the average hourly pay for assistant stadium usher in the United States is $16.26,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.38 and $18.03 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Assistant Stadium Usher vs Stadium Usher?

AspectAssistant Stadium UsherStadium Usher
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; some roles may require customer service experienceHigh school diploma or equivalent; customer service skills preferred
Work EnvironmentSports stadiums, arenas, large event venuesSports stadiums, arenas, large event venues
Employer & IndustrySports teams, event organizers, stadium managementSports teams, event organizers, stadium management
Job ResponsibilitiesAssist stadium ushers, support crowd management, provide customer assistanceGuide spectators, enforce stadium policies, assist with seating

Both Assistant Stadium Ushers and Stadium Ushers work in similar environments and share many skills. The assistant role typically involves supporting the main ushers and handling additional customer service tasks, while stadium ushers focus more on guiding spectators and enforcing policies. The roles are often interchangeable depending on the venue's needs.

Job description

Stadium Ushers are the face of the guest services experience at Breese Stevens Field. Interested candidates should have a positive attitude, outgoing personality, and work well in group settings.
Responsibilities include:
  • Greet and assist customers to their seats while maintaining a positive attitude and a smile.
  • Become an expert of the stadium layout, seating areas, and guest amenities.
  • Recognize situations which require escalation to Full-Time staff to ensure customer satisfaction and/or safety.
  • Stadium Ushers may be assigned to working entrance gates, using handheld scanners to screen admission tickets.
  • Stadium Ushers may be assigned to work reserved parking areas to ensure only authorized guests use the limited number of available parking spaces.
  • Stadium Ushers may be responsible for reviewing guest tickets to monitor access to hospitality sections, including providing wristbands to eligible guests.
  • Stadium ushers are expected to treat all guest in a respectful manner.
  • Stadium Ushers will be asked to stand for extended periods of time and move around the stadium as needed.
  • Maintain a positive, safe, and fun work environment.
  • As an usher, greeter or ticket taker, you help to ensure safety and help maintain the cleanliness access points while engaging with guests to assist with their needs before, during and after the event.
  • Assist in verifying staff credentials to generally restricted areas.
  • Assist patrons by giving directions places inside or outside the venue.

Requirements include:
  • Ability to stand and/or walk for extended periods of time (~ 4-8 hours/shift).
  • Must be able to remain in a stationary standing position for 50% or more of the shift.
  • Must be able to effectively communicate in a respectful manner with guest and staff.

Stadium Ushers are hired for the outdoor event season at Breese Stevens Field which typically runs from May to late October. This is a part-time, hourly position with most scheduled work occurring in the late-afternoon and evening. Scheduled shifts can be both weekdays and weekends.
